CHICAGO, Sept. 8,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Latham & Watkins LLP1 is pleased to announce that Mohammed Shaheen has rejoined the firm's Chicago office as a partner in the Banking & Private Credit Practice. Shaheen represents banks and private credit funds in complex credit facilities, leveraged and acquisition financings, and restructurings.

Shaheen has significant experience representing lenders in both the syndicated and private markets and in restructurings across a variety of industries. His practice focuses on the structuring, negotiation, and administration of senior credit facilities, including acquisition, asset-based, bridge, cross-border, and multi-currency financings.

Shaheen rejoins Latham from Stanford University, where he was engaged in education and research. Shaheen was a partner in Latham's Banking & Private Credit Practice from 2014 to 2019. He received his JD from Harvard Law School and BA from the University of Chicago.
